No cost email services have become the main way of communication on this modern web. Today most of us owns an email service like Gmail, Outlook and Yahoo mail. These three no cost email services remains the center of email communication from many years. But with the advancement of modern computer technology more and more email services are coming for public use.
Choosing a best zero cost email service a complex. We have to evaluate every feature of an email service before using that. The features which we evaluate are speed, security, anti-spam features, productivity, storage space, apps for mobile devices and many more. We should always choose a fast, secure and reliable email service.

There many email service provider available to use but it is very difficult to choose the best service among them. In this article, we have researched top best email service provider which are built for the user. We have evaluated every feature of below listed no cost email services.

Gmail

Gmail is the most used & best no cost email service around the globe. Gmail is also among the most popular service from Google. Gmail provides plenty of features to its users. This email service from tech giant Google provides a very simple user interface. Most of the people around the world prefer Gmail over any other email service. Some of its rock-solid features include:

  • Storage: Gmail provides 15GB of storage to its users. You can use this storage for Google Drive and Google Plus photos. If you are with Gmail, you don’t have to worry about going out of storage space.
  • Security: As Gmail is world’s biggest tech organization Google, security should not be the point to worry about. Gmail comes with some of the best security features in industry. These features include HTTPS, malware & phishing protection and best anti-spam shield. It also provide two-step authentication feature.
  • Productivity: Gmail also includes hefty productivity features. As Gmail is integrated with Google Drive, you can send email attachments up to 10GB. All of the emails are organized in four tabs Primary, Social, Promotions and Updates by default. It supports both POP and IMAP. You can search the email right from inbox.
  • Send Money: Gmail has also got a feature of sending money. This feature is available in few countries now.
  • Mobile Apps: Gmail apps for mobile is available for Android and iOS.

Outlook.com

Outlook.com is famous email service from Microsoft. Previously it was known as Hotmail. Like Gmail, Outlook provides a cleaner user interface inspired by metro UI of Windows 8. Outlook.com provides better privacy features than Gmail. It features includes:

Microsoft Office Integration:

  • Microsoft Office is fully integrated in Outlook.com so that you can easily create and view office files directly in email dashboard.
  • It provides practically unlimited storage.
  • Industry standard spam filtering and virus scanning.
  • Skype is integrated right in Outlook.com
  • Use of DMARD for better security.
  • POP3, IMAP and EAS are supported.
  • Social Media Integration let you to chat with your Facebook friends.

Yahoo Mail

Yahoo Mail is another popular web-based email service. This email service is provided by Yahoo. When you will sign up for Yahoo Mail, you will given 1TB (1000GB) of email storage. Yahoo messenger is already integrated in Yahoo mail. Both POP and IMAP are supported by this email service.
Its anti-spam features are best in class. It also provide SMS messaging. Its interface is somewhat similar to Outlook.com
AOL Mail
AOL is the short name of America Online. AOL mail is also a popular & no cost web-based email service. Some of its features include unlimited email storage, spam & virus protection, SSL based process, spell checker and much more. POP3, IMAP and SMTP are supported.
AOL Mail is one of the best service made for personal use.
Yandex Mail
Yandex Mail offers a full, rich and usable email experience with powerful web access, mobile apps, POP as well as IMAP access and unlimited storage.
Functions such as message templates, reminders, e-cards and keyboard shortcuts help handle mail with efficiency and fun in Yandex Mail; still, its rules could be more versatile, text snippets would support templates.

Inbox.com

Inbox.com comes with 5GB of email storage. It is a email service with a standard offering of features and tools. The service possesses an intuitive interface, which is arguably the easiest to use of all the email account services we reviewed. This benefit is offset somewhat by the lack of many important features for the modern internet user, though.

GMX Email

GMX Email meets all your basic emailing needs with no complaints. Message composition, contacts, organizers and more are all present and functioning properly. A couple standout features place it above most of its competing services.

iCloud Mail

iCloud Mail is an email service from Apple with ample storage, IMAP access and an elegantly functional web application.
That interface at icloud.com does not offer labels or other more advanced tools for productivity and for organizing mail, though, and does not support accessing other email accounts.

So these are top best email services. Among all top 3 including Gmail, Outlook.com and Yahoo mail remains as the top email services from many years. Most of the internet users are using these three email service. But you can also try for other email service given in the list.
All of other email services also give better services to the user so you can also opt for them
